The Transformative Power of 'Go': A Journey Through Five Years of Sobriety
“Go means to go out there and to be of maximum helpfulness to others.”
Ever thought about the significance of a single word in your recovery journey? In this episode of the Sober Moments Podcast, Karen dives into the story of Julie, who chose the word 'go' for her five-year sobriety medallion. Julie's early struggles with the concept of God led her to a profound realization: serving others was her path to faith and purpose. 'Go' became her guiding principle, a reminder to be of maximum help to those around her.
Karen unpacks the biblical inspirations behind Julie's choice and shares how this simple word has been a beacon in her own recovery.
